NoX World - форум об игре NoX

 
Пожалуйста, войдите или зарегистрируйтесь.

Войти
Расширенный поиск  
Сейчас онлайн стрима нет!
Сейчас на сервере никого нет!

Обязательно все ознакомьтесь с новыми Правилами Портала!

Актуальные новости:
IP сервера изменён! Новый IP: 45.144.64.229. Сервер также доступен через Westwood Online (XWIS, игру через сервер)


Важные темы:
Как играть по сети? Понятное руководство!
Правила Сервера NoxWorld.
Как помочь форуму финансово?

Просмотр сообщений

В этом разделе можно просмотреть все сообщения, сделанные этим пользователем.

Сообщения - KirConjurer

Страниц: [1] 2 3 ... 13
1
NoX / Как русифицировать OpenNox?
« : 09/06/2024 21:19:22 »
Привет.
Процесс русификации подробно изложен в этой теме https://forum.noxworld.ru/nox/vse-o-perevodah/
Если кратко - заменяешь файлы шрифтов (*.fnt), затем файл со строками (nox.csf), затем по желанию диалоги (папка Dialog) и ролики (папка MOVIES).

2
Поскольку тема апнута, докину и свой взгляд на добавление/удаление карт.
Добавить на сервер и в мапцикл:
1. worldend
2. minetomb
3. DthTmple - вариация на тему minimine
4. fallest - вариация на тему estate

Только добавить на сервер, но не в мапцикл:
1. Pyramid (не в мапцикл)
2. SkyColor (баланс зон слабоват для мапцикла)
3. foresto (баланс слабоват для мапцикла)
4. catacomb (баланс слабоват для мапцикла)
5. estnight - вариация на тему estate

Предложение карт на удаление из mapcycle:
1. zndun
2. Waterwar
3. Inferno заменить на Inferno2

+ есть идея для доработки spyfort, в частности хочется добавить двери в "межстенные коридоры", т.к. воинам из них выбраться часто тяжко

3
Привет! Используй режим эмуляции PS/2 мыши, а не планшетного сенсора, в настройках ВМ. Не могу быть уверен что такая настройка есть в чистом Hyper-V, но в Virtualbox и qemu помогало.
Проблема идёт из за того что Нокс нативно не умеет обрабатывать абсолютное позиционирование мыши, только дельту.

4
Прочее / Тема для оффтопа II
« : 07/12/2021 00:15:06 »
EvilWisp, привет! Какие люди!)

5
Выпущено обновление редактора 10.17
Исправлены проблемы, имевшиеся в предыдущей версии 10.16 (забыл опубликовать на форуме...): Проблема при сохранении карт из одиночной кампании, при которой они повреждались и не загружались в игре, а только в редакторе;
Проблема при сохранении карт с лазерными установками (SentryGlobe) когда они все разворачивались в одном направлении;
Проблема при определении директории игры, не дававшая в некоторых случаях запустить редактор вообще.
Так же были некоторые мелкие фиксы.

Скачать:

https://bitbucket.org/AngryKirC/noxedit2014/downloads/

Поддержать автора можно переводом денежки через PayPal на адрес kirillmurz (соб@ка) yandex.ru.
Старый номер карты указанный в теме уже всё.

6
Прочее / Тема для оффтопа II
« : 10/01/2020 21:25:39 »
Ура, форум ожил!
Делаем... Но не совсем Nox 2. :)

7
Ребят подскажите, какой файл нужно редактировать, чтобы в сетевой игре можно было колдуном призывать урчина шамана и прочую братию, которая есть в сингле?
thing.db.

8
Прочее / Тема для оффтопа II
« : 09/07/2019 07:13:58 »
А у тебя как дела?
Закончил свой технарь в июне. На данный момент являюсь военнообязанным. В этом году должны забрать :щ
Работаю... где, лучше пока умолчу)
Забавно, как жизнь всё переставляет.

9
Прочее / Тема для оффтопа II
« : 30/06/2019 20:53:27 »
Призываю вас, призраки форума!
Нокс ещё не забыт, думаю и на форум ещё пара глаз, да заглядывает изредка.
Вспоминаете ли НВ? Чем сейчас занимаетесь ИРЛ?

11
Моддинг / UniMod3
« : 04/06/2018 14:34:01 »
Привет. Я бы рад помочь, но... не вижу смысла. Коммьюнити Нокса сейчас опять впало в спячку -- начало лета, сдача экзаменов...
Катарсис занимается своим проектом по Nox-тематике, в свободное время я занимаюсь своим. Там тоже будет применён Lua, кстати.
Из зарубежных моддеров сейчас активен только Panic (который всё делает на скриптах редактора).
Грустно, но не думаю, что сейчас время начинать делать новый Юнимод.

Свою базу данных, однако, выслал на e-mail. Осторожно, структуры малость глюченые.
ЗЫ: Да что с форумом творится, ё-моё! Шрифты бунтуют.

12
Bober2090, будут, но нескоро. Так вышло, что ближайшие дней 6 у меня не будет доступа к компьютеру... Поэтому my apologies.
Возможно, за это время найдётся кто то ещё, кто сможет эти файлы извлечь.
Есть одна маленькая заморочка, к слову -- NoxTools не умеет корректно обрабатывать полупрозрачность в изображениях (ФоН, призраки) однако за исключением вышеупомянутого призрака монстров с полупрозрачностью в Нокса вроде как нет, так что это не должно стать проблемой.

13
Как заставить его отрисовываться со своими анимациями (по структуре они 1 в 1 как у игрока)? Нужно использовать другой адрес игровой функции для update? Или дело не в этом? И возможно ли это вообще?
Без радикального вмешательства в код игры это невозможно, т.к. функция отрисовки спрайта игрока затрагивает другие структуры данных, отличные от тех что используются для НПС (playerInfo и иже с ними).
В .exe файле смещение процедуры playerDraw 004B8270, к слову, если хочется самому посмотреть.
Создать виртуального игрока/структуру для этих целей тоже не так то просто, потребуется проделать немалое количество махинаций с движком игры, и в результате стабильность никакая будет.

14
Есть следующий вопрос - с юнимодом создаю NPC через createObject, закидываю ему цвета куда надо - NPC невидим, хотя бегает и пинается. Что нужно, чтобы сделать его видимым? (подсмотрено у KirConjurer в скриптах для создания conjbot'а - есть функция для экипировки брони ботом, после чего тот становится видимым; внутри функции вызов какой то функции игры по адресу с передачей аргументов - на кого одевать и что одевать - как это может быть связано с отрисовкой npc? О_о)
Всё просто: недостаточно просто создать НПС, так как игра ориентирована на клиент-серверную архитектуру, клиенту игры ещё необходимо отправить пакет, который будет описывать характеристики этого НПС (такие как цвет кожи, цвет волос...)
Эта функция, помимо всего прочего, этот самый пакет и отправляет, а ещё отмечает НПС как "изменившегося" (если ему одели броню, то клиент об этом тоже должен узнать!)
Если пролистать файлик NPCEdit в самый конец, то там есть и функция (update/sendNPCData), которая вызывает отправку этих данных.
Вот её то как раз и нужно вызывать, чтобы сделать НПСку видимым, только не сразу, а с задержкой в 1 фрейм (смотри spawnNPC.lua)

15
2Mihheo, это, конечно, возможно в теории, однако до такого наши технологии ноксокопания ещё не дошли. (И вряд ли дойдут.)
Максимум, чего удалось добиться, так это подмены спрайтов монстра. У игрока же там слишком навороченные структуры (для каждого предмета выстраивается свой кадр, а потом они складываются в определённой последовательности, и т.д...)

2Bober2090 -- там очень много всего, если распаковать его весь, без сортировки, это будет каша.
Перечислите названия объектов (тех вещей спрайты которых вам нужны), я вам достану.

16
NoX / Разговоры о Nox 2
« : 29/06/2017 13:22:12 »
Есть тут один такой персонаж, который когда-то очень горел желанием сделать свой "Нокс 2".
Но увы, ему так и не удалось прийти к здравому консенсусу между тем видением игры, которое он мог получить, и тем, которое необходимо для того чтобы игра стала действительно запоминающейся и отличной от других.
Это я.

17
NoX / Помощь в прохождении
« : 08/06/2017 06:16:57 »
В Книге знаний (слева от панели заклинаний) посмотри, у тебя оно уже изучено должно быть.
Читерим, ага?)

18
С днём рождения, NoxWorld. Спасибо за то хорошее время, что я провёл здесь.

19
Судя по тексту ошибки, у тебя проблемы не с редактором, а с .NET framework или системой.
Попробуй переустановить 3.5 и 4.0 версии фреймворка. https://www.microsoft.com/ru-ru/download/details.aspx?id=22

20
Nox 1.2 с установленным патчем Микса.
P.S. Почему же редактор карт заточен только под версию Нокса 1.2b?

Странно, тогда всё должно работать. Попробуй другую версию игры установить.
По вопросу: потому что это последняя официальная версия Нокса. Патч Микса не затрагивает файлы ресурсов.

21
Понятно, у меня старый редактор карт Нокса, поэтому я устанавливаю его новую версию.
UPD: Редактор должен обязательно работать.
UPD2: После установки новой версии редактор всё ещё не работает. Нужна помощь с редактором карт. Текст ошибки:
<...>
P.S. Для работы редактора нужен запущенный Нокс или нет?

Какая версия Нокса у тебя установлена? 1.0? 1.2b? GOG?
Формат файлов в разных версиях может отличаться, поэтому это важно. Сам редактор "заточен" только под 1.2b.
По вопросу: нет, для работы редактора запускать Нокс не нужно.

22
Привет!
У меня почему-то не запускается редактор карт для Nox. Прошу помощи.
<...>

У тебя старая версия редактора. Люди давно уже запилили более современный редактор с кучей новых фич и режимом совместимости.
Скачать можно тут: https://www.dropbox.com/sh/m5hrglvpe9o6spk/AAC0uzvNExVmWBDuytBv3UrJa?dl=0
Ветка с редактором на буржуйском форуме:

23
Заголовок говорит сам за себя.
Энтузиазм, идеи и необходимые ресурсы имеются, нужно только ваше мнение.

Заранее отвечаю на пару очевидных вопросов.
Что же есть в моём понимании "гибридная текстовая RPG", и почему именно она?

Во-первых, соотношение затраты/качество: с проработкой такой игры может справиться и один человек... вопрос лишь, насколько качественно.
С помощью текста можно передать такие вещи, которые с помощью графики передать сложно - к примеру, сложные эффекты заклинаний, запахи, детали предметов окружения, ощущения, и т.д.

Во-вторых, встроенный редактор, модульность (движок->игрок->мир->объекты->свойства->взаимодействия->тексты), скрипты, кастомизируемость каждого элемента геймплея предоставят очень широкий инструментарий для игровых дизайнеров, создание игрового мира станет не нудной и тяжкой работой, а приблизится к развлечению для души. В свою очередь, это приблизит вероятность того, что игра будет закончена.
Всё в целом позволит поддерживать атмосферу не хуже нынешних AAA игр.
Единственное, чего я боюсь - неудачной компоновки интерфейса или отклонения в модульном game flow, в результате которого может получиться неудобная и костыльная игра-эксель с кучей графомании и рычагов настроек, которые пользователь просто никогда не найдёт.
В-третьих, в качественных текстовках сравнительно высокая интерактивность: можно будет сжечь деревья заклинанием, ломать стены, собирать предметы своими руками, брать в руки чужие столы... - то самое, чем в те времена блеснул на фоне других ARPG Нокс.

Как ЭТО будет выглядеть?
Spoiler (click to show/hide)

То, конечно, очень приближённо. Интерфейс игры будет сильно отличаться... пользователю нужно будет переключаться между окнами карты, способностей, инвентаря и много ещё чего, попутно не теряя текст - "глаза персонажа" и данные о текущем состоянии мира, из виду, за как можно меньшее количество щелчков и нажатий клавиш.
Насчёт конкретной реализации ничего обещать ещё не могу. Удобнее всего, конечно, было бы реализовать это как отдельное кроссплатформенное клиентское приложение, возможно конечно и как серверную браузерку, но для синглплеерной игры это выглядит не лучшим решением. Для разработки сейчас думаю юзать чистый C/C# в связке с Lua для описания гибкой логики (объекты, скрипты) плюс отдельный комплекс разработки (редактор+генератор карт со встроенным редактором игровых ресурсов, скриптов, и диалогов) и парой либ для вывода звука и текста (терминал?).

Но в это же будет сложно играть!

У меня имеется несколько задумок, призванных упростить восприятие игры (группировка событий, фильтр важности сообщений...)
Здесь нужно спросить у каждого пользователя - что именно, на ваш взгляд, делает TRPG сложными для восприятия?
Имхо, хорошо продуманный интерфейс позволит избежать многих граблей уже существующих текстовок. Особенно с перемещением и обзором.
Возможно, в игре так же будут музыка и звуковые реакции на некоторые события.

Ну и пользуясь случаем подкину ещё несколько вопросов аудитории.
Не интересно - не отвечайте, право ваше, я не обижусь.

Какой же сценарий без главного героя. Как вы хотите видеть завязку, откуда он родом?
1. Оставить сюжет попаданца, как в оригинале. (Special case: Сам Джек)
2. Наследник (родственник) Джека, родом из Нокса.
3. Случайный житель Нокса.

На что, по вашему мнению, стоит поставить приоритет?
1. Небольшой, но проработанный, линейный или не очень мир, с чётким сценарием для каждого класса.
2. Большой, открытый мир, с разбросанными квестами, без жесткого сценария и навязывания действий игроку.

Нужна ли в игре сложная система повреждений, или стоит оставить классику - хитпоинты?

1. Да, если делать на совесть - реализм же!
2. Нет, это добавит сложности в геймплей.
3. Нет, это добавит сложности в реализацию.

Ваше мнение очень важно для нас меня.

24
Может есть где нибуть дока по этому редактору и маппингу в нему, или может кто-то с опытных старожилов может состряпать, думаю, что многие начинающие мапперы были бы очень благодарны.... а если ещё дать примеры и типичные приемы использования.....
P.S. я понимаю, что это всё труд, но здесь всё на интузиазме, к тому же новые карты были бы доступны сообществу.
Спасибо за отзыв.
Документации для нового редактора, увы, никакой нет. И вряд ли она появится наперёд нормального компилятора скриптов..
Tutorial по старому (оригинальному) редактору (на английском) можно найти здесь: http://nox.wikia.com/wiki/Map_Editor
Есть, однако, на форуме мапперы "старой школы", которые возможно захотят поделиться своим опытом.

Алсо, на случай если сюда вдруг забредёт человек что пожелает поддержать разработчика... Номер карты, который я ранее указал, теперь недействителен. Не тратьте деньги попусту.

25
Клан NoX Craft / Макет NoX в Minecraft
« : 02/07/2016 16:10:29 »
Товарищи НоксКрафтовцы, не могли бы вы перезалить данную карту?

Копируемая карта: con02a
Версия карты: 1.3
Совместимость с Minecraft версиями: от 1.3 до 1.8
Требуемые модификации: отсутствуют
Тип карты: Декоративно-обозревательный

Страниц: [1] 2 3 ... 13

Страница сгенерирована за 0.067 секунд. Запросов: 16.